Hamstring Stretch (Sitting) Sit on bench with leg to be stretched extended in front of you, toes up, and the opposite foot resting on the floor. Slowly bend forward from the hips keeping the back straight until a stretch is felt behind the knee. Hold 20 to 30 seconds. Repeat times/leg. 5. Hamstring Stretch (Doorway) Lie on back in a doorway. WebFeb 23, 2024 · To stretch your hamstring muscles: Lie on the floor near the outer corner of a wall or a door frame. Raise your left leg and rest your left heel against the wall. Keep your left knee slightly bent. Gently straighten your left leg until you feel a stretch along the back of your left thigh. Hold for about 30 seconds.
